October 20, 2022Game drives in Lake Mburo National Park, Lake Mburo National Park is one of the best parks in Uganda to do safari game drives giving you an opportunity to view various wildlife which include Giraffes, Zebras, Elands, Topis, Impalas among others. Lake Mburo National Park is the smallest savannah national park in Uganda; it is a home to an impressive diversity of wildlife with 69 mammal species and 332 bird species. Lake Mburo National Park is the only park in Uganda that contains impalas and the only one in western Uganda where you can see the Zebras, Giraffes and Elands. Safari Game Drives in Lake Mburo can be done in the morning, mid-morning, afternoon, evening and night these give you an opportunity to see a variety of savanna animals and birds. The location of Lake Mburo national park makes it the quickly and easier accessible national park from Kampala or Entebbe offering you a day’s trip for you to enjoy the safari game drives in Lake Mburo.

What to see during game drives in Lake Mburo National Park
Wildlife
Lake Mburo National park contains an impressive diversity of wildlife with 69 mammal species, a number of this park’s herbivores are rarely and many are only found here. Lake Mburo is the only park in Uganda where you can find the impalas and the only one in western Uganda where you can see the Giraffes, Zebras and Elands. Leopards and hyenas are also present though rarely sighted in the park. Hippos and crocodiles can as well be sight during a boat trip on Lake Mburo. Wildlife in Lake Mburo can be sighted during game drives and best time is during the morning and evening hours. Night game drives are also done in the park giving you a chance to see nocturnal animals such as bushbabys, pottos and depending on luck a leopard.
Birds
Lake Mburo National Park is one of the best places for bird watching in Uganda and it attracts many avian tourists throughout the year, the park has over 332 recorded bird species. Many papyrus and acacia species can be spotted in the park such as the papyrus gonelok, papyrus yellow warbler, white-winged warbler and the shoebill stork. It is one of the places in Uganda to see the shoebill stork.
Local Ankole Cattle
Parts of Lake Mburo National Park are grazing areas for various local herds’ men whom on your game drive in some parts of the park you will be able to meet with this giving you an opportunity to see and learn about the local tradition Ankole cattle, only fond in Uganda commonly described as the cattle with long horns

What is the best time to do game drives in Lake Mburo National Park
The best time to visit Lake Mburo National Park for Safari Game Drives is during the dry months of December to February and then June to October during this time the road accessing the park are dry and driving through is easy compared to wet season and doing the safari game drives in the park is much more easy as drive through the tracks is not hard.
How much are Game drives in Lake Mburo National Park
Game drives in Lake Mburo National Park, the day game drive that is done between 7am to 6pm costs USD40 for foreign non residents, USD30 for foreign residents, 20,000 Uganda Shillings for East African Citizens for Adults and then for Children it is USD20, USD10 and 5000 Uganda Shillings respectively. The Night Game drive which starts after 6pm costs USD30 for the foreign non residents, USD30 foreign residents and 50,000 Uganda Shillings for East African Citizens the rates are based on per person as per Uganda Wildlife Authority official tariff for entrance fees in Uganda National parks.

How to access Lake Mburo National Park for Safari Game Drives
By Road: Lake Mburo National Park is located between the towns of Masaka and Mbarara close to the main south western road that links Kampala to Bwindi Impenetrable forest national park. It is 228km drive from Kampala to Lake Mburo National Park which takes you approximately 3-4 hours drive each way. The park can be accessed from various main gates which include Kyanyanshara Gate linking you to Mihingo Lodge, Akagate Gate and Sanga Gate which leads you to Rwakobo Rock Lodge. The park is close to the main road making it easy for accessibility you will need to follow sign posts of Uganda Wildlife Authority.
By Air; Flying Safari to Lake Mburo National Park is also available via charter and scheduled flights from Kajjansi and Entebbe International Airport, operators of these route include Aero Link Uganda and Fly Uganda among others. This however needs to be booked in advance given the fact the routing is mostly determined by the number of travelers aboard the flight with the minimum being 4 people.
Where to stay during Safari Game Drives in Lake Mburo
Lodge options in Lake Mburo National Park you can stay in range from budget, mid-range to luxury. Budget options include Rwonyo Rest Camp, UWA Bandas and Campsite, Leopard Rest Camp and Mantana Tented Camp among others fares range from 90-100 dollars a night per person, mid-range options include Rwakobo Rock Lodge, Mpongo Lodge, Mburo Safari Lodge and Acadia Lodge among others fares range from 100-200 dollars a night per person and then Luxury options Mihingo Safari Lodge and Emburara Lodge among others fares range from 200-400 dollars a night per person.
